Location:Finsbury Barracks, City Rd, London EC1Y 2BQ
Finsbury barracks, home to the HAC Regiment, is well located in the City of London, being close to both Moorgate and Liverpool St underground stations. The outside of the building is an impressive building, resembling a castle, with the inside providing a more modern space.
With large interconnecting classrooms, the location is ideal for training. When opened up, the classrooms can accommodate up to 120 people or can be split into 4 classrooms of 20-40 people.
The bar and dining room on the top floor has an expansive view of the Honourable Artillery Company’s Garden, the biggest garden in the centre of London. The bar can hold receptions for up to 100 people.
